Press Release - December
8th 2006
The ‘South West Catchments Council’ has contracted
Spatial Vision to undertake the development of their Waterway
Health Sub-strategy and an associated Investment Decision
Support System.
The South West Catchments Council (SWCC) is a cooperative
regional organization which identifies and coordinates strategic
opportunities to achieve sustainable natural resource management
(NRM) in the South West of Western Australia.
The rationale for SWCC investment in this project is to develop
a prioritization framework to guide investment into strategically
determined river and estuary protection and recovery projects.
This project will provide SWCC with tools for an informed
and defensible process for making funding allocation decisions
related to the region’s water assets. The project is
funded by the Australian and Western Australian Governments
through the National Action Plan for Salinity and Water Quality.
Spatial Vision will lead the project and involve the additional
NRM expertise of Shelley Heron and Tim Doeg.
